Document 1/7/121 (RRS, iii, no. 118)
- Description
- King Alexander II has granted composition made between William [Malveisin], bishop of St Andrews, and Abbot Ralph and convent of Arbroath concerning lands, rents and conveth of Fyvie (ABD) and Tarves (ABD), Inverboyndie (Boyndie, BNF), 'Munbre' (lost?, in Boyndie), Gamrie (ABD) and Inverugie (ABD), and Mondynes (KCD), which Bishop William granted and quitclaimed to abbot and convent, reserving ancient rent of Mondynes, that is, 3s. 6d., and a portion of conveth which used to be paid at Banchory-Ternan (KCD), in return for 10 marks payable yearly by chamberlain of Arbroath, as chirograph made between the parties bears witness.
- Firm date
- 30 March 1226
